利用Python绘制长方形图形的方法
发布时间: 2024-03-28 07:49:06 阅读量: 320 订阅数: 27
python图片画矩形框
# 1. I. 简介
在计算机编程领域,绘制图形是一项常见的任务。长方形作为一种基本的几何图形,在各种应用中都有广泛的应用。利用Python语言,我们可以使用不同的库来绘制长方形,从而实现各种图形化需求。本文将介绍如何利用Python绘制长方形图形的方法,主要涉及三种常用的库,即Turtle、Matplotlib和OpenCV。通过本文的学习,读者将掌握使用Python绘制长方形的技巧,为后续图形绘制工作打下基础。接下来,让我们开始准备工作。
# 2. II. 准备工作
在开始绘制长方形图形之前,我们需要确保计算机中已经安装了相应的库和工具。以下是准备工作的步骤:
1. **安装Python**:确保计算机中已经安装了Python编程语言。可以从官方网站 https://www.python.org/ 下载并安装最新版本的Python。
2. **安装所需库**:本文将使用Turtle库、Matplotlib库和OpenCV库来绘制长方形图形,需要通过Python的包管理工具(如pip)来安装这些库。可以使用以下命令来安装:
```bash
# 安装Turtle库
pip install PythonTurtle
# 安装Matplotlib库
pip install matplotlib
# 安装OpenCV库
pip install opencv-python
```
3. **编辑器选择**:为了编写和运行Python代码,您可以选择任何喜欢的文本编辑器或集成开发环境(IDE),比如VSCode、PyCharm等。
确保完成上述准备工作后,我们就可以开始利用Python绘制长方形图形了。
# 3. III. 使用Python的Turtle库绘制长方形
在本章节中,我们将使用Python的Turtle库来绘制长方形图形。Turtle库是一个绘制图形的库,类似于Logo编程语言中的turtle绘图。
```python
import turtle
# 创建Turtle对象
t = turtle.Turtle()
# 绘制长方形
for i in range(2):
t.forward(200) # 向前移动200个像素
t.right(90) # 右转90度
# 保持窗口打开
turtle.
```
0
0